  • Title

    A workflow coordination model for mobile agents based on role and task

  • Abstract
    To resolve problems such as mobile computing, mobile agent is being widely accepted for its characteristics such as platform independence, autonomy, mobility etc. However, the availability of so many agents to work on a single application presents a new challenge to information technology: coordination between a large number of concurrent active entities. Based on the research of the current coordination technology, this paper promotes a workflow coordination model based on tasks and roles, which provides an effective way to implement the coordination between mobile agents, and overcomes the weakness in describing agent action dependency, and resource access control that may exist in other coordination models.
